Our lives can be crazy, but you can take a break from it all with Wondery’s new series, Even the Rich, where co-hosts Brooke Siffrinn and Aricia Skidmore-Williams pull back the curtain and chat about someone else’s craziness for a change. They tell stories about some of the greatest family dynasties in history, from the Murdochs to the Royals to the Carters (Jay-Z and Beyoncé, that is). Chappaquiddick | The Reckoning | 30
Ted Kennedy's political future is in danger due to the Chappaquiddick scandal. He hopes to regain public favor by revealing what really happened. The episode explores the responsibilities and challenges faced by Kennedy wives. New details about the car accident and Ted's delayed report are uncovered. Ted and Joan attend Mary Jo's funeral, attracting attention and speculation. Ted expresses remorse and confronts reporters, but the press attention only intensifies. The episode also discusses the details of the Chappaquiddick incident and the public's response.

The House of Versace | Make It Work | 26
Donatella Versace's struggle to succeed as head of the fashion empire, her spiraling drug addiction, and the pressure of living up to Gianni's legacy. Her family confronts her, urging her to seek help. Donatella checks into rehab, makes a successful comeback with a fashion show, and Versace eventually turns a profit.
